PaDutyCycle settings (0, 4 and 7) in LDO configuration.
Similarly to the DC-DC configuration, we can notice that at a given supply voltage, a higher PaDutyCycle setting increases
the device current consumption. However, the supply voltage has no influence on the current consumption at a given
PaDutyCycle setting, which means that the plots for 1.8 V, 3.3 V, and 3.7 V are superimposed.
Figure 9-7
and
Figure 9-8
show that the power efficiency of the Low Power PA is maximized when the internal DC-DC
regulator is used at or above 3.3V.
